Trade unions reach out to migrant workers

[Migrant Labour - Related News]

In a district that has thousands of workers from other States, employed in industries, retail outlets, and farmlands, some of the trade unions have started enrolling these workers in the unions. According to K.M. Selvaraj of engineering workers' union (AITUC), there are several challenges in enrolling the migrant workers in the unions. They work for six to eight months and go home for at least a month during festivals. When they return, they might join work in another unit.
